Christian Keyes is celebrating a major milestone after All The Queen’s Men reached the No. 1 position on Paramount+, further proving the show’s popularity among viewers.
After remaining relatively quiet on premiere day, Keyes finally addressed fans following the series’ impressive achievement. The actor, writer, and creator took to social media to express his gratitude to the audience that has supported the franchise throughout its run.
In his message, Keyes thanked viewers for their loyalty and dedication, making it clear that the show’s continued success would not be possible without its passionate fanbase.
His comments quickly resonated with supporters, many of whom have followed the series since its debut and have consistently helped generate buzz online.
The celebration did not stop there.
Alongside acknowledging the show’s streaming success, Keyes revealed that a new book connected to the All The Queen’s Men universe is expected to become available for pre-order next week.
The announcement immediately generated excitement among fans eager to dive deeper into the franchise and its characters.
The timing is especially significant as the hit drama approaches what has been described as its final chapter. For many viewers, the book announcement offers another opportunity to stay connected to the story world beyond the television screen.
